Wednesday 13 November 2013

A Lighthouse Keeper's Story


It was very nearly full house last night at our November meeting when members and visitors listened to a fascinating talk by Gordon Partridge about his 22 years as a Lighthouse Keeper.

Gordon gave us a bit of the history of lighthouses in the UK - first introduced by Henry VIII - and followed the story from beacons through to the present day computerisation of lighthouses.

We were given a glimpse of the day to day living conditions of a lighthouse man as well as learning about the challenges and fun that Gordon had in his career.  It was an excellent talk - very entertaining and informative.  Thank you Gordon!
